The agent of Porto striker Hulk claims that "big clubs in England" are interested in signing his client, with Manchester United reportedly one of his possible suitors.
QUOTE Hulk's agent claims English interest as Man Utd circle Now literally, we could have a REAL HULK in the team.Hulk enjoys a growing reputation in Europe, not least due to his unusual nickname, and while he has been far from prolific in the Portuguese league this season, he did score three goals as Porto qualified from the same group as Chelsea in the Champions League. It is reported that Manchester United have been monitoring his progress and have taken note of the 23-year-old's formidable physical presence - a quality that has served him well since his move from Tokyo Verdy in the summer of 2008. Hulk's agent, Tedoro Fonseca, claims that a move to the Premier League could be an option for the player at the end of the current campaign. "The big clubs in England have been in contact," Fonseca," told the News of the World. "They have asked for details about his contract situation but any decision about his future rests mainly with the directors of Porto. "I am calm about the situation and so is the player because he has an excellent future.
